> > It seems that C::A::D always sets the runmode to
> $rm_HTTP_METHOD even when $rm is not set, which produces a
> _HTTP_METHOD runmode. that' doesn't work when start_mode is
> expected to be run. it is due to the following code in the
> sub dispatch { } from CAD,
> >
> > if( $auto_rest )
> {
> > my
> $method_lc = defined $named_args->{auto_rest_lc} ?
> $named_args->{auto_rest_lc} : $args{auto_rest_lc};
> > my
> $http_method = $self->_http_method;
> >
> $http_method = lc $http_method if
> $method_lc;
> >
> $rm .= "_$http_method";
> > }
> >
> > I just had to change the first line to
> >
> > if( $auto_rest && $rm )
> >
> >
> > doesn't anyone see this as a problem?

sorry for the late reply.
without auto_rest set, C::A::D works with no rm defined in the dispatch rule
and set the rm to the startmode if it is set in the dispatched module.
'/people/:people/:rm?' => { app => 'User' },
with auto_rest and no rm => in dispatch rule, as I said in my previous email,
C::A::D sets the rm to $rm_HTTP_METHOD which becomes _GET _PUT etc...
